## Service Accounts — StormFan Alert Fan-Out

The fan-out worker authenticates to the internal dispatch tier using the svc-stormfan account. Rotate quarterly; scopes are limited to publish-only on alert topics. If deliveries stall during your shift, verify the worker is using the current credential, reproduced below for reference.

API key for kaweg-hahif: kto4_rAjZ

# Break-Glass Access: Ledgewood Static Builds

Incremental rebuilds on the Ledgewood site occasionally wedge the cache index, requiring emergency access to the build signer. Break-glass use is logged, reviewed weekly, and limited to one unseal per incident. Reviewers should confirm the audit trail before approval. The signer accepts only the recovery passphrase directly below.

vault phrase of yagag-kadup = belael-druius-rusax-kelox

Handover for Brackenmoor partner drop. The nightly SFTP pull from Tallowfen lands in the ingest bucket around 02:15; files are PGP-encrypted and must decrypt before the parser runs at 03:00. If a file is missing, wait one hour — their scheduler is flaky — then ping their ops channel. Don't rename files; the manifest checker matches exact names. Rotation of the drop credentials happens quarterly; it's documented in the vault runbook. The transfer job runs with the configuration values listed here.

settings of fafog-haduf:
ZORIX_PIN=4648
ZORIX_METRICS_HOST=metrics.zorix.paliqsys.corp
ZORIX_LOG_LEVEL=info
ZORIX_TENANT=druix

## Websocket compression: Fernvale gateway

permessage-deflate stays OFF for authenticated channels — compression plus attacker-influenced payloads risks a CRIME-style leak. It may be enabled for public, read-only feeds only. Context takeover must remain disabled everywhere to bound memory. Any exception needs security sign-off before deploy. Each approved config change is stamped with a trace token, shown directly beneath this section.

build token for yaduf-kajef: htk3_cc1